Once you have downloaded the necessary zip folders, you must extract them into the correct directory structure inside your main ePSXe 1.6.0 folder. Step 1: Placing the BIOS Extract your downloaded scph1001.bin file. Open your main directory. Locate the folder named bios . Move or copy the .bin file directly into this folder. ePSXe uses a modular plugin system. Separate plugin files (.dll) handle video rendering, audio output, and controller configurations. Choosing the right plugin determines your frame rates, visual resolution, and audio synchronization. Finding and Downloading the Files
